Bucks report: Getting inside
Contrary to public sentiment, new Bucks general manager John Hammond doesn't have any intentions of making massive changes to the team's roster this summer. Hammond said he believes the Bucks' roster has several "assets" on it, and is especially intrigued by the talent and potential of center Andrew Bogut and power forward Yi Jianlian. Hammond has also publicly stated he likes the Bucks' starting backcourt of point guard Mo Williams and shooting guard Michael Redd, whom he called a "great player." The one position Hammond said he'll likely address, though, is small forward. Veterans Desmond Mason and Bobby Simmons manned that spot last season and produced modest results. Ideally, the Bucks want a small forward who has a well-rounded game and doesn't have the limitations of Mason -- no perimeter game -- and Simmons -- no interior game.
